2015-12-14 60 views
-2

我有两个网站(与Cpanel分开管理)。我想在另一台主机上使用数据库。从Php脚本连接到远程Mysql数据库

域和他们的mysql端口是:abc.com:2082和xyz.com:2082。

我想通过运行在xyz.com上的Php脚本在abc.com上使用数据库。但是,当我尝试连接到数据库时,连接显示错误:“错误”。

+0

是什么错误显示?具体并将其编辑到您的问题上,而不是作为评论 – RiggsFolly

+0

也有很多主机会禁用此功能。在甚至开始进程 – RiggsFolly

回答

0

那么,您可以通过两种方式首先使用数据库凭证连接数据库。在这种情况下,您需要启用mysql远程权限。如果提供%,则任何来自任何IP地址的人都可以连接到您的数据库。

其次,您可以使用restful api来交换两者之间的数据。在stackoverflow中了解更多关于restful api搜索。

+0

之前,请检查它是否可以与'abc.com'的主机一起使用,在那里我必须放置%? –

+0

http://support.hostgator.com/articles/cpanel/how-to-whitelist-your-ip-in-cpanel-for-remote-mysql-access – jewelhuq